Ticket: PRNT-2214 — Spoolhawk credentials expired

The Spoolhawk printer-spooler microservice stopped accepting jobs at 04:32 because its internal gateway key lapsed. Queue is backing up in the Marbury office. A replacement key has been issued; redeploy the spooler config with it and confirm jobs drain. The new key is below.

gateway credential: kto23_LX9A4ys6i4nzHtpOLNLodKK

# KioskGuard Watchdog Service Account

The watchdog restarts the Fernvale kiosk app if the heartbeat stops for 45 seconds. It runs under the `kg-watchdog` service account, scoped to restart and log-read only. Do not widen its permissions. Logs ship to the Lanternpost aggregator every five minutes. If the watchdog itself dies, the kiosk reboots on a hardware timer. The account authenticates to the internal Lanternpost ingest API with a static key, rotated quarterly. Current key follows.

gateway credential: zpat15_lMLOSdhT94y0U3l

## Runbook: GraphQL N+1 fix (Ostrel API)

Symptom: resolver fan-out hammers the orders DB. Fix shipped in the batching loader; it's env-gated.

Set `BATCH_LOADER_ENABLED=true` and `BATCH_WINDOW_MS=5`. Restart the API pods, then confirm query count drops in the Quillgraph dashboard. If latency spikes, lower the window, don't disable batching. Cache layer needs `LOADER_CACHE_TTL=30`.

The loader signs its cache entries; put the signing secret on the next line.

sealed setting: ARCHIVE_KEY3=8d0

- [ ] Step 7: Archive cold storage buckets (Glacierline tier). Confirm both ceremony witnesses are present, verify bucket manifests match the Oxbow ledger, then seal the archive key shares. Plugin authors may observe but not handle shares. Once sealed, the archive index itself is encrypted and can only be reopened with the passphrase below.

vault phrase of badup-hahig = tamael-aldael-kelmir-istael-fenok-istwyn-tamius-jorath-oliion